/** * Method to instantiate the view. * * @param Model $model The model object. * @param Container $container DI Container. * @param array $config View config. * @param SplPriorityQueue $paths Paths queue. */ public function __construct(Model $model = null, Container $container = null, $config = array(), \SplPriorityQueue $paths = null) { $config['grid'] = array('option' => 'com_fbimporter', 'view_name' => 'item', 'view_item' => 'item', 'view_list' => 'items', 'order_column' => 'item.catid, item.ordering', 'order_table_id' => 'itemList', 'ignore_access' => false); // Directly use php engine $this->engine = new PhpEngine(); parent::__construct($model, $container, $config, $paths); }
/** * Method to instantiate the view. * * @param Model $model The model object. * @param Container $container DI Container. * @param array $config View config. * @param SplPriorityQueue $paths Paths queue. */ public function __construct(Model $model = null, Container $container = null, $config = array(), \SplPriorityQueue $paths = null) { $config['grid'] = array('option' => 'com_copymodules', 'view_name' => 'module', 'view_item' => 'module', 'view_list' => 'modules', 'order_column' => 'module.catid, module.ordering', 'order_table_id' => 'moduleList', 'ignore_access' => true, 'field' => array('state' => 'published')); // Directly use php engine $this->engine = new PhpEngine(); parent::__construct($model, $container, $config, $paths); }